端口扫描是一种网络安全技术,用于检测目标主机上开放的端口,以了解其可能的服务和潜在的安全风险。对于新手来说,掌握端口扫描软件的操作和界面是非常重要的。本文将详细解析一款常见的端口扫描软件,帮助新手轻松入门。
端口扫描基础知识
在开始操作之前,我们需要了解一些端口扫描的基础知识。
端口概念
端口是计算机与网络进行通信的通道,类似于电话的号码。每个端口对应一种服务,例如HTTP服务通常运行在80端口。
端口扫描类型
- TCP端口扫描:检测目标主机上TCP端口是否开放。
- UDP端口扫描:检测目标主机上UDP端口是否开放。
- 综合端口扫描:同时检测TCP和UDP端口。
常见端口扫描软件
以下以“Nmap”为例,介绍端口扫描软件的操作和界面。
Nmap简介
Nmap(Network Mapper)是一款功能强大的开源端口扫描工具,支持多种扫描技术和协议。
Nmap安装
由于Nmap是开源软件,您可以从其官方网站下载安装包。以下是Windows系统的安装步骤:
- 访问Nmap官网:https://nmap.org/
- 下载适用于Windows的Nmap安装包。
- 运行安装程序,按照提示完成安装。
Nmap操作
- 打开命令行窗口。
- 输入以下命令:
nmap [目标IP地址]
例如,扫描本地主机的所有端口:
nmap 127.0.0.1
Nmap界面详解
Nmap提供了命令行和图形界面两种操作方式。以下以图形界面为例进行介绍。
- 打开Nmap图形界面。
- 在“Target”栏中输入目标IP地址。
- 在“Scan Type”栏中选择扫描类型,如“TCP SYN Scan”。
- 点击“Scan”按钮开始扫描。
Nmap扫描结果分析
扫描完成后,Nmap会显示以下信息:
- Open Ports:开放的端口列表。
- Closed Ports:关闭的端口列表。
- Filtered Ports:被防火墙过滤的端口列表。
通过分析这些信息,您可以了解目标主机上运行的服务和潜在的安全风险。
总结
掌握端口扫描软件的操作和界面对于网络安全爱好者来说至关重要。本文以Nmap为例,详细介绍了端口扫描的基础知识、软件安装、操作和界面详解。希望对新手有所帮助。
